[0031] In the present invention, the XG-PON system mainly includes the central office equipment OLT and the remote equipment ONU (Optical Network Unit, optical network unit). The OLT is located on the operator side and is used to manage and maintain the access of the ONU; the ONU is located on the user side and provides various service access functions for the user. The OLT in the XG-PON system mainly includes two functional modules according to the function division: PON MAC module and TM module. When processing data flows of different users and different services, the PON MAC module realizes the data flow between the XGEM flow and the Ethernet flow. Mutual mapping, the data flow processed by the TM module is an Ethernet flow, which realizes the flow management function. In the present invention, different user data services are mapped to Ethernet flows with different XGEM Port-IDs, and the XG-PON system implements flow management of Ethernet flows based on XGEM Port-IDs.

Abstract

The invention discloses an XG-PON system flow management device and method. The method comprises the following steps: in the uplink direction, a PON-MAC module maps an uplink XGEM flow into an Ethernet flow and inserts the outermost layer VLAN of which the VLAN ID is equal to XGEM Port-ID; a TM module realizes the uplink flow management based on the XGEM Port-ID, then removes the outermost layer VLAN, and records a mapping relation table of an upper Ethernet flow identification and the XGEM Port-ID; in the downlink direction, the TM module can acquire the corresponding XGEM Port-ID according to an Ethernet identification and the mapping relation table, and insert the XGEM Port-ID to the outermost layer VLAN to realize the downlink flow management; the PON MAC module acquires the corresponding XGEM Port-ID according to the mapping relation table, then removes the outermost layer VLAN and sends the XGEM Port-ID to an ONU (optical network unit). The method disclosed by the invention can effectively ensure the integrity and reliability of the flow management function of the XG-PON system, and meet the requirement on data flow subdivision and reasonable customer service management of operators because the number of users accessed to the net is increased and the service capacity is expanded.

technical field [0001] The present invention relates to a PON system, in particular to an XG-PON system flow management device and method. Background technique [0002] In the context of global informatization, broadband access is developing rapidly. XG-PON technology has become the most representative and widely applicable next-generation optical access technology in the industry. With the increase of access network users and the continuous expansion of equipment, the access network system is becoming larger and larger. Operators are paying more and more attention to the QoS (Quality of Service) of network equipment. How to ensure that the network carries multiple services Transmission reliability, QoS of corresponding services, and reasonable flow management have become the focus of the industry.
